Automatic Transmission
Operation (Base)
The shift lever is located on the
console between the seats.
There are several different positions
for the automatic transmission.
P (Park):This position locks the
front wheels. It is the best position
to use when you start the engine
because the vehicle cannot move
easily.
{CAUTION
It is dangerous to get out of the
vehicle if the shift lever is not fully
in P (Park) with the parking brake
rmly set. The vehicle can roll.
Do not leave the vehicle when the
engine is running unless you have
to. If you have left the engine
running, the vehicle can move
suddenly. You or others could be
injured. To be sure the vehicle will
not move, even when you are on
fairly level ground, always set the
parking brake and move the shift
lever to P (Park). SeeShifting Into
Park (Automatic Transmission) on
page 2-25. If you are pulling a
trailer, seeTowing a Trailer on
page 4-35.
Make sure the shift lever is fully in
P (Park) before starting the engine.
The vehicle has an automatic
transmission shift lock control
system. You have to fully apply theregular brakes rst and then press
the shift lever button before you can
shift from P (Park) when the ignition
key is in ON/RUN. If you cannot shift
out of P (Park), ease pressure on the
shift lever and push the shift lever all
the way into P (Park) as you maintain
brake application. Then press the
shift lever button and move the shift
lever into another gear. SeeShifting
Out of Park on page 2-27.
R (Reverse):Use this gear to
back up.
Notice:Shifting to R (Reverse)
while the vehicle is moving
forward could damage the
transmission. The repairs would
not be covered by the vehicle
warranty. Shift to R (Reverse)
only after the vehicle is stopped.
To rock the vehicle back and forth
to get out of snow, ice or sand
without damaging the transmission,
seeIf Your Vehicle is Stuck in Sand,
Mud, Ice, or Snow on page 4-27.

Manual Shift Mode (MSM)
(Automatic Transmission)
To use this feature, do the following:
1. Move the shift lever from
D (Drive) rearward to M (Manual).
The six-speed transmission will
downshift to a lower gear and the
instrument panel will display the
gear range selected. If equipped
with a 4-speed transmission it will
display a 3 for third gear range.
When coming to a stop in
the manual position, the vehicle
will automatically shift to
1 (First) gear.
2. Press the plus (+) button to
upshift or the minus (−) button
to downshift.While using the MSM feature
the vehicle will have sportier
performance. You can use this
when driving hilly roads to stay
in gear longer or to downshift for
more power or engine braking.
The transmission will only allow you
to shift into a gear range appropriate
for the vehicle speed.
The transmission will not
automatically shift to the next
higher gear range without
pressing the button on the
shifter handle.
The transmission will not allow
shifting to the next lower gear if
the vehicle speed is too high.
If the vehicle does not respond
to a gear change, or detects a
problem with the transmission, the
range of gears may be reduced and
the Malfunction Indicator Lamp will
come on. SeeMalfunction Indicator
Lamp on page 3-35.

Electric Power
Management
The vehicle has Electric Power
Management (EPM) that estimates
the battery’s temperature and state
of charge. It then adjusts the voltage
for best performance and extended
life of the battery.
When the battery’s state of charge is
low, the voltage is raised slightly to
quickly bring the charge back up.
When the state of charge is high,
the voltage is lowered slightly to
prevent overcharging. If the vehicle
has a voltmeter gage or a voltage
display on the Driver InformationCenter (DIC), you may see the
voltage move up or down. This is
normal. If there is a problem, an alert
will be displayed.
The battery can be discharged at
idle if the electrical loads are very
high. This is true for all vehicles. This
is because the generator (alternator)
may not be spinning fast enough at
idle to produce all the power that is
needed for very high electrical loads.
A high electrical load occurs when
several of the following are on,
such as: headlamps, high beams,
fog lamps, rear window defogger,
climate control fan at high speed,
heated seats, engine cooling fans,
trailer loads, and loads plugged into
accessory power outlets.
EPM works to prevent excessive
discharge of the battery. It does this
by balancing the generator’s output
and the vehicle’s electrical needs.It can increase engine idle speed to
generate more power, whenever
needed. It can temporarily reduce
the power demands of some
accessories.
Normally, these actions occur
in steps or levels, without being
noticeable. In rare cases at the
highest levels of corrective action,
this action may be noticeable to the
driver. If so, a Driver Information
Center (DIC) message might be
displayed, such as BATTERY
SAVER ACTIVE, BATTERY
VOLTAGE LOW, or LOW BATTERY.
If this message is displayed, it is
recommended that the driver reduce
the electrical loads as much as
possible. SeeDIC Warnings and
Messages on page 3-49.

DIC Warnings and
Messages
Messages are displayed on the DIC
to notify the driver that the status
of the vehicle has changed and that
some action may be needed by
the driver to correct the condition.
Multiple messages may appear
one after another.
Some messages may not require
immediate action, but you can
press any of the DIC buttons,
or the trip odometer reset stem
on the instrument panel cluster to
acknowledge that you received the
messages and to clear them from
the display.
Some messages cannot be cleared
from the DIC display because they
are more urgent. These messages
require action before they can be
cleared. Take any messages that
appear on the display seriously
and remember that clearing the
messages will only make the
messages disappear, not correct
the problem.

The label shows the gross
weight capacity of your vehicle.
This is called the Gross
Vehicle Weight Rating (GVWR).
The GVWR includes the
weight of the vehicle, all
occupants, fuel, cargo, and
trailer tongue weight, if
the vehicle is pulling a trailer.
The Certication/Tire label also
tells you the maximum weights
for the front and rear axles, called
the Gross Axle Weight Rating
(GAWR). To nd out the actual
loads on your front and rear
axles, you need to go to a weigh
station and weigh your vehicle.
Your dealer/retailer can help you
with this. Be sure to spread out
your load equally on both sides of
the centerline.
Never exceed the GVWR for
your vehicle or the GAWR
for either the front or rear axle.{CAUTION
Do not load the vehicle any
heavier than the Gross Vehicle
Weight Rating (GVWR), or
either the maximum front or
rear Gross Axle Weight Rating
(GAWR). If you do, parts on
the vehicle can break, and it
can change the way your
vehicle handles. These could
cause you to lose control and
crash. Also, overloading can
shorten the life of the vehicle.

Tire Size
The following illustration shows
an example of a typical
passenger vehicle tire size.
(A) Passenger (P-Metric) Tire
:The United States version of a
metric tire sizing system. The
letter P as the rst character in
the tire size means a passenger
vehicle tire engineered to
standards set by the U.S. Tire
and Rim Association.
(B) Tire Width
:The three-digit
number indicates the tire section
width in millimeters from sidewall
to sidewall.(C) Aspect Ratio
:A two-digit
number that indicates the tire
height-to-width measurements.
For example, if the tire size
aspect ratio is 60, as shown in
item C of the illustration, it would
mean that the tire’s sidewall is
60 percent as high as it is wide.
(D) Construction Code
:A letter
code is used to indicate the type
of ply construction in the tire.
The letter R means radial ply
construction; the letter D means
diagonal or bias ply construction;
and the letter B means
belted-bias ply construction.
(E) Rim Diameter
:Diameter of
the wheel in inches.
(F) Service Description
:These
characters represent the load
index and speed rating of the tire.
The load index represents the
load carry capacity a tire is
certied to carry. The speed
rating is the maximum speed a
tire is certied to carry a load.
Tire Terminology and
Denitions
Air Pressure:The amount of air
inside the tire pressing outward
on each square inch of the tire.
Air pressure is expressed in
pounds per square inch (psi)
or kilopascal (kPa).
Accessory Weight
:This means
the combined weight of optional
accessories. Some examples
of optional accessories are,
automatic transmission, power
steering, power brakes, power
windows, power seats, and air
conditioning.
Aspect Ratio
:The relationship
of a tire’s height to its width.
Belt
:A rubber coated layer of
cords that is located between the
plies and the tread. Cords may
be made from steel or other
reinforcing materials.
